Another underrated game was Bad Mojo. Most of you probably never heard of it, but it's a game where you are transformed into a cockroach and run around amok in gritty places like sewers and pipes! Not for the faint of heart, there's some fish that leaps out of the water and giant spiders that may scare the hell out of ya....

I'd say Rez as well. The perfect blend of music and imagery yet in a video game.

And The Zone of the Enders is NOT underrated, the game just isn't that good. The music and graphics are awesome, and the controls are tight, but for the most part it just isn't fun. The boss fights are just horrible. It's not that the game completely sucks (some parts are really entertaining), but it's not really underrated. At least the second one isn't, I haven't played the first one.
